At its core, Religion is not portrayed through overt imagery such as crosses, crescents, or mandalas. Instead, it emerges subtly through intent and symbolism. The leaf shape itself has long held sacred significance across numerous spiritual traditions—Buddhism venerates the Bodhi tree under which the Buddha attained enlightenment; in Christianity, the olive branch is a universal symbol of peace and divine favor; indigenous cultures worldwide honor specific plants as living manifestations of ancestral spirits or deities. By choosing a leaf as its primary form, this icon taps into these deep-rooted spiritual associations without relying on dogma or doctrinal imagery. The absence of religious texts, figures, or elaborate ornamentation does not diminish its sacredness—it elevates it. The icon becomes a vessel for universal spirituality: one that is personal, inclusive, and non-denominational.
